home *** CD-ROM | disk | FTP | other *** search
- DOS_DOS_HDOS_DOS_HEXEC_TYPES_H"exec/types.h"DOSNAME "dos.library"DOSTRUE (-1L)DOSFALSE (0L)MODE_OLDFILE 1005MODE_NEWFILE 1006MODE_READWRITE 1004OFFSET_BEGINNING -1OFFSET_CURRENT 0OFFSET_END 1OFFSET_BEGINING OFFSET_BEGINNINGBITSPERBYTE 8BYTESPERLONG 4BITSPERLONG 32MAXINT 0x7FFFFFFFMININT 0x80000000SHARED_LOCK -2ACCESS_READ -2EXCLUSIVE_LOCK -1ACCESS_WRITE -1
- DateStamp{
- ds_Days;
- ds_Minute;
- ds_Tick;
- };TICKS_PER_SECOND 50
- FileInfoBlock{
- fib_DiskKey;
- fib_DirEntryType;
- fib_FileName[108];
- fib_Protection;
- fib_EntryType;
- fib_Size;
- fib_NumBlocks;
- DateStamp fib_Date;
- fib_Comment[80];
- fib_OwnerUID;
- fib_OwnerGID;
- fib_Reserved[32];
- };FIBB_OTR_READ 15FIBB_OTR_WRITE 14FIBB_OTR_EXECUTE 13FIBB_OTR_DELETE 12FIBB_GRP_READ 11FIBB_GRP_WRITE 10FIBB_GRP_EXECUTE 9FIBB_GRP_DELETE 8FIBB_SCRIPT 6FIBB_PURE 5FIBB_ARCHIVE 4FIBB_READ 3FIBB_WRITE 2FIBB_EXECUTE 1FIBB_DELETE 0FIBF_OTR_READ (1<<FIBB_OTR_READ)FIBF_OTR_WRITE (1<<FIBB_OTR_WRITE)FIBF_OTR_EXECUTE (1<<FIBB_OTR_EXECUTE)FIBF_OTR_DELETE (1<<FIBB_OTR_DELETE)FIBF_GRP_READ (1<<FIBB_GRP_READ)FIBF_GRP_WRITE (1<<FIBB_GRP_WRITE)FIBF_GRP_EXECUTE (1<<FIBB_GRP_EXECUTE)FIBF_GRP_DELETE (1<<FIBB_GRP_DELETE)FIBF_SCRIPT (1<<FIBB_SCRIPT)FIBF_PURE (1<<FIBB_PURE)FIBF_ARCHIVE (1<<FIBB_ARCHIVE)FIBF_READ (1<<FIBB_READ)FIBF_WRITE (1<<FIBB_WRITE)FIBF_EXECUTE (1<<FIBB_EXECUTE)FIBF_DELETE (1<<FIBB_DELETE)FAULT_MAX 82
- ¥¡;
- ¥BSTR;°OBSOLETE_LIBRARIES_DOS_HBADDR(bptr) ((()bptr)<<2)BADDR(x) (()(()(x)<<2))MKBADDR(x) ((()(x))>>2)
- InfoData{
- id_NumSoftErrors;
- id_UnitNumber;
- id_DiskState;
- id_NumBlocks;
- id_NumBlocksUsed;
- id_BytesPerBlock;
- id_DiskType;
- ¡id_VolumeNode;
- id_InUse;
- };ID_WRITE_PROTECTED 80ID_VALIDATING 81ID_VALIDATED 82ID_NO_DISK_PRESENT (-1)ID_UNREADABLE_DISK (0x42414400L)ID_DOS_DISK (0x444F5300L)ID_FFS_DISK (0x444F5301L)ID_INTER_DOS_DISK (0x444F5302L)ID_INTER_FFS_DISK (0x444F5303L)ID_FASTDIR_DOS_DISK (0x444F5304L)ID_FASTDIR_FFS_DISK (0x444F5305L)ID_NOT_REALLY_DOS (0x4E444F53L)ID_KICKSTART_DISK (0x4B49434BL)ID_MSDOS_DISK (0x4d534400L)ERROR_NO_FREE_STORE 103ERROR_TASK_TABLE_FULL 105ERROR_BAD_TEMPLATE 114ERROR_BAD_NUMBER 115ERROR_REQUIRED_ARG_MISSING 116ERROR_KEY_NEEDS_ARG 117ERROR_TOO_MANY_ARGS 118ERROR_UNMATCHED_QUOTES 119ERROR_LINE_TOO_LONG 120ERROR_FILE_NOT_OBJECT 121ERROR_INVALID_RESIDENT_LIBRARY 122ERROR_NO_DEFAULT_DIR 201ERROR_OBJECT_IN_USE 202ERROR_OBJECT_EXISTS 203ERROR_DIR_NOT_FOUND 204ERROR_OBJECT_NOT_FOUND 205ERROR_BAD_STREAM_NAME 206ERROR_OBJECT_TOO_LARGE 207ERROR_ACTION_NOT_KNOWN 209ERROR_INVALID_COMPONENT_NAME 210ERROR_INVALID_LOCK 211ERROR_OBJECT_WRONG_TYPE 212ERROR_DISK_NOT_VALIDATED 213ERROR_DISK_WRITE_PROTECTED 214ERROR_RENAME_ACROSS_DEVICES 215ERROR_DIRECTORY_NOT_EMPTY 216ERROR_TOO_MANY_LEVELS 217ERROR_DEVICE_NOT_MOUNTED 218ERROR_SEEK_ERROR 219ERROR_COMMENT_TOO_BIG 220ERROR_DISK_FULL 221ERROR_DELETE_PROTECTED 222ERROR_WRITE_PROTECTED 223ERROR_READ_PROTECTED 224ERROR_NOT_A_DOS_DISK 225ERROR_NO_DISK 226ERROR_NO_MORE_ENTRIES 232ERROR_IS_SOFT_LINK 233ERROR_OBJECT_LINKED 234ERROR_BAD_HUNK 235ERROR_NOT_IMPLEMENTED 236ERROR_RECORD_NOT_LOCKED 240ERROR_LOCK_COLLISION 241ERROR_LOCK_TIMEOUT 242ERROR_UNLOCK_ERROR 243RETURN_OK 0RETURN_WARN 5RETURN_ERROR 10RETURN_FAIL 20SIGBREAKB_CTRL_C 12SIGBREAKB_CTRL_D 13SIGBREAKB_CTRL_E 14SIGBREAKB_CTRL_F 15SIGBREAKF_CTRL_C (1<<SIGBREAKB_CTRL_C)SIGBREAKF_CTRL_D (1<<SIGBREAKB_CTRL_D)SIGBREAKF_CTRL_E (1<<SIGBREAKB_CTRL_E)SIGBREAKF_CTRL_F (()1<<SIGBREAKB_CTRL_F)LOCK_DIFFERENT -1LOCK_SAME 0LOCK_SAME_VOLUME 1LOCK_SAME_HANDLER LOCK_SAME_VOLUMECHANGE_LOCK 0CHANGE_FH 1LINK_HARD 0LINK_SOFT 1ITEM_EQUAL -2ITEM_ERROR -1ITEM_NOTHING 0ITEM_UNQUOTED 1ITEM_QUOTED 2DOS_FILEHANDLE 0DOS_EXALLCONTROL 1DOS_FIB 2DOS_STDPKT 3DOS_CLI 4DOS_RDARGS 5